Abstract
The utility model relates to a pipe and the mouthing-making machine with one-extrusion moulding which relates to a concrete tile canister pipe making machine which is used for a pipe and a bell being extruded and formed. A gearset driven by a micro worm reducer rotates to prompt a crank link mechanism to operate so that a connecting big tongue or a roller is pushed out the outer of an inner mold or is retracted into the inner mold. So a tile canister and the bell are one time extruded and formed. The utility model has the advantages of simple operation and high productive efficiency. The structure of the pipe making machine is simplified, and the material is reduced so that the self weight of the device is lightened about 2 ton.

The utility model relates to a kind of concrete tile tube tuber that is used for pipe shaft and bellmouth extrusion modling.
In prior art, vertical tube extruding machine is to adopt twin axle, and promptly axle is exclusively used in the extrusion modling of pipe shaft, and another root axle then is exclusively used in the extrusion modling of bellmouth, and watt of tube needs respectively two stations moulding fully through two axle places.Even single axle, the bell of pipe comes moulding by a special-purpose chieftain of platform top, that is to say that pipe shaft and bellmouth come moulding respectively by two parts of tuber respectively.Therefore, there is the equipment heaviness in the prior art tubulation, mechanism's complexity, weak point such as operating procedure is various, and production efficiency is lower.
The purpose of this utility model be to provide a kind of have can be used for the pipe shaft moulding, can be used for the tuber of core part of two kinds of functional unifications of bellmouth moulding again, so that an extrusion modling of pipe shaft and bellmouth.
The utility model is realized by following design: at fuse of the present utility model of end lifting of the main shaft of tuber, it can rotate and lifting with main shaft, thus the extrusion modling pipe shaft; When said fuse rises to certain height with main shaft, make the miniature worm reducer of fuse inside drive one group of gear revolution certain angle by motor, thereby allow a toggle be in the position, dead point, the other end of connecting rod is released workpiece.And the workpiece that stretches out thus extruding bellmouth, reach and make pipe shaft and the one-time formed purpose of bellmouth.
The utility model is owing to the fuse that is adopted can be released the bellmouth of workpiece extruding diameter greater than pipe shaft by machinery, thereby reach pipe shaft and bellmouth one-shot forming after the pipe shaft extrusion modling.Therefore, effect of the present utility model is tangible.The step that can simplify the operation widely improves efficiency of equipment.Simultaneously, simplified the structure of equipment itself, reduced the volume and the material of equipment itself, compared with the same category of device in the prior art, deadweight can alleviate about 2 tons.
